Animal welfare
The Centre for Animal Welfare and Ethics (CAWE) is the prime site for animal welfare research in the School, but staff in a variety of other sections of the School are also involved in animal welfare research.
Project areas and staff researching in those areas include:
- Welfare of livestock on farm and during transport and slaughter: Professor Clive Philips, Dr David McNeill, Ms Michelle Sinclair
- Welfare of cats and dogs in animal shelters: Professor Clive Phillips, Emeritus Professor Jacquie Rand, Dr Mandy Paterson
- Welfare of captive wild animals and horses: Professor Clive Phillips, Dr Lisa Kidd
- Alternative delivery systems for analgesia in cattle: Professor Paul Mills, Dr Steven Kopp, Professor Michael McGowan
- Determining desexing status in dogs surrendered to animal shelters: Honorary Professor Jonathan Hill
